Guiding Principles for Ethical Animal Research

Replacement

The principle of replacement involves using alternative methods that do not involve animals whenever possible. Researchers should explore non-animal models and technologies to reduce the use of animals in research.

Reduction

The principle of reduction focuses on minimizing the number of animals used in research. Researchers should carefully consider the sample size needed for their studies and implement strategies to reduce the overall number of animals involved.

Refinement

The principle of refinement aims to improve the welfare and minimize the suffering of animals used in research. Researchers should implement measures to enhance the housing, handling, and care of animals to ensure their well-being.

Regulatory Framework for Ethical Animal Research

Animal Welfare Act

The Animal Welfare Act sets standards for the humane care and treatment of animals used in research. It requires researchers to provide appropriate housing, food, and veterinary care for animals and to minimize pain and distress.

Guidelines from Institutional Animal Care and Use Committees

Institutional Animal Care and Use Committees (IACUCs) oversee animal research at institutions and ensure compliance with ethical guidelines. Researchers must obtain approval from IACUCs before conducting any animal research.
